Employee Benefits: The Only Guide You Need

Achievers - Recruiting

The term “employee benefits” is used regularly, but often with a limited, traditional definition in mind. The traditional concept refers to legally mandated benefits plus a few voluntarily added by employers. What are employee benefits? . Employee benefits are non-salary compensation and perks.

On-demand pay: the pros and cons of earned wage access

Workable

By offering flexibility and control over earnings, on-demand pay is reshaping the employee compensation landscape. The idea of on-demand pay is to provide financial flexibility, which has a range of benefits for both employees and employers. There are intangible benefits as well.
